What does a BT do?
The Behavior Technician provides individualized, one-on-one intervention to teach communication, social, and daily living skills and reduce problematic behaviors in the home, community, and school settings. Behavior Technicians implement interventions developed based on the science of Applied Behavior Analysis, as directed and supervised by a BCBA. The BCBA assigned to your case will meet with you at least once weekly to guide how to structure sessions with the child to maximize the time that you spend with the youth, making sure that you are addressing the goals that have been formulated for the youth.
